什么是全空间三维数据库

回复

共3条回复 我来回复
  • 飞飞的头像
    飞飞
    Worktile&PingCode市场小伙伴
    评论

    全空间三维数据库是一种用于存储、管理和查询三维地理数据的数据库。它在地理信息系统(GIS)领域中被广泛应用,用于处理各种类型的三维数据,如地形数据、建筑物数据、地下管网数据等。全空间三维数据库可以存储大量的三维数据,并提供高效的数据查询和分析功能。

    以下是关于全空间三维数据库的五个要点:

    1. 数据存储和管理:全空间三维数据库使用高度优化的数据结构和存储技术,可以有效地存储和管理大规模的三维地理数据。它能够支持各种数据类型和格式,并提供灵活的数据模型,使用户可以根据自己的需求定义和组织数据。

    2. 数据查询和分析:全空间三维数据库提供强大的数据查询和分析功能,可以进行空间查询、属性查询和拓扑分析等操作。用户可以通过空间关系、属性条件和空间范围等方式对数据进行查询,以获取所需的信息。此外,全空间三维数据库还支持复杂的分析操作,如路径分析、可视化分析和空间模型等。

    3. 三维数据可视化:全空间三维数据库能够实现三维数据的可视化展示,以提供更直观的数据呈现方式。用户可以通过三维地图、模型和图表等方式来展示和分析数据,以便更好地理解和解释地理现象和空间关系。

    4. 数据共享和协作:全空间三维数据库支持数据的共享和协作,使多个用户可以同时访问和编辑数据。它提供了权限管理和版本控制等功能,以确保数据的安全性和一致性。此外,全空间三维数据库还可以与其他系统和平台进行集成,实现数据的互操作性和共享性。

    5. 应用领域:全空间三维数据库在许多领域都有广泛的应用。例如,城市规划和建设领域可以利用全空间三维数据库来进行建筑物模拟和可视化分析;地质和矿产勘探领域可以利用全空间三维数据库来进行地质建模和资源评估;交通和物流领域可以利用全空间三维数据库来进行路径规划和交通拥堵分析等。

    总之,全空间三维数据库是一种功能强大的数据库技术,可以有效地存储、管理和查询三维地理数据。它在各种领域都有广泛的应用,并为用户提供了丰富的数据分析和可视化工具。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    全空间三维数据库是一种用于存储和管理三维空间数据的数据库系统。它是在传统的二维数据库基础上发展起来的,通过引入第三维度的概念,可以更加准确地描述和分析现实世界中的空间信息。

    全空间三维数据库主要包括以下几个方面的内容:

    1. 数据模型:全空间三维数据库采用的数据模型通常是基于对象的数据模型,可以将空间数据表示为三维对象,如点、线、面、体等。这些对象可以包括地理信息系统(GIS)中的地物、地理空间数据库(GDB)中的实体等。

    2. 数据结构:全空间三维数据库需要支持对三维空间数据的存储和查询,因此需要设计相应的数据结构来组织和管理数据。常见的数据结构包括空间索引结构,如R树、四叉树等,用于提高空间数据的查询效率。

    3. 空间查询:全空间三维数据库可以支持各种类型的空间查询,包括点定位、范围查询、邻近查询、路径分析等。通过这些查询功能,用户可以方便地获取所需的空间信息,进行空间分析和决策。

    4. 数据可视化:全空间三维数据库还可以提供数据可视化的功能,将三维空间数据以可视化的方式呈现给用户。这样用户可以更直观地理解和分析空间数据,提高对空间信息的理解和利用。

    全空间三维数据库在很多领域都有广泛的应用,如城市规划、地质勘探、交通管理、环境保护等。它为各种空间数据的存储、查询和分析提供了强大的支持,帮助用户更好地理解和利用三维空间信息。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    全空间三维数据库是一种用于存储、管理和查询三维空间数据的数据库系统。它是在传统的二维数据库的基础上发展而来的,增加了对第三维度的支持,可以存储和处理具有空间位置信息的数据。全空间三维数据库广泛应用于地理信息系统、城市规划、地质勘探、物流管理等领域。

    全空间三维数据库的设计和实现需要考虑以下几个方面:

    1. 空间数据模型:全空间三维数据库需要定义合适的数据模型来描述三维空间数据。常用的空间数据模型包括欧几里得空间模型、网格模型和三角剖分模型等。这些模型可以用来表示点、线、面和体等几何对象,并提供相应的操作和查询方法。

    2. 索引结构:为了提高查询效率,全空间三维数据库通常使用空间索引结构来组织和管理空间数据。常见的索引结构包括R树、四叉树、八叉树和网格索引等。这些索引结构可以将空间数据划分为不同的区域,并支持快速的范围查询和最近邻查询等操作。

    3. 空间查询语言:全空间三维数据库需要提供一种方便用户查询空间数据的语言。常见的空间查询语言包括SQL语言的扩展版本和专门的空间查询语言。这些语言可以用来描述空间查询的条件和操作,如范围查询、邻近查询和交叉查询等。

    4. 空间数据可视化:全空间三维数据库可以通过可视化技术将存储在数据库中的空间数据以图形的方式展示出来。这样可以帮助用户更直观地理解和分析空间数据。常见的空间数据可视化技术包括三维地图、立体视图和动态演示等。

    全空间三维数据库的操作流程通常包括以下几个步骤:

    1. 数据采集:首先需要采集三维空间数据,可以通过测量仪器、卫星遥感、激光雷达等方式获取。采集的数据可以是点云数据、三维模型、DEM数据等。

    2. 数据导入:将采集到的数据导入到全空间三维数据库中。通常需要对数据进行预处理和清洗,去除噪声和异常值,然后按照数据库的数据模型进行格式化和导入。

    3. 数据管理:对导入到数据库中的三维空间数据进行管理。包括数据的存储、索引和备份等操作。可以根据需要对数据进行分区、压缩和加密等处理。

    4. 数据查询:根据用户的需求,使用合适的查询语言和查询条件进行空间数据的查询。可以通过范围查询、邻近查询和交叉查询等方式获取所需的数据。

    5. 数据分析:对查询到的空间数据进行分析和处理。可以使用统计分析、空间插值和模型建立等方法进行数据分析和建模。

    6. 数据可视化:将分析结果以图形的方式展示出来,帮助用户更好地理解和解释空间数据。可以使用三维地图、立体视图和动态演示等技术进行数据可视化。

    7. 数据输出:根据用户的需求,将查询和分析的结果输出为图形、表格或报告等形式。可以导出为常见的文件格式,如Shapefile、KML和CSV等。

    总之,全空间三维数据库是一种专门用于存储、管理和查询三维空间数据的数据库系统。它通过合适的数据模型、索引结构和查询语言,可以方便地进行空间数据的存储、查询和分析。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部